#The 7 Lowest-Calorie Alcoholic Drinks:
Alcoholic drinks can be a significant source of calories and can easily contribute to weight gain if consumed in excess. However, if you're looking for low-calorie options, here are 7 options.
Vodka Soda: A classic, simple drink that consists of vodka and soda water. A 1.5 oz serving of vodka with soda water contains only about 65 calories.
Wine Spritzer:
Mix a 5 oz glass of wine with soda water for a refreshing spritzer that comes in at about 100 calories.
Light Beer:
A 12 oz serving of light beer typically contains around 100 calories, making it a good option for those who enjoy beer but want to cut back on calories.
Champagne:
A 4 oz glass of champagne contains around 85 calories, making it a great option for celebrations.
Gin and Tonic:
Mix 1.5 oz of gin with tonic water for a classic cocktail that comes in at around 120 calories.
Rum and Diet Coke:
A 1.5 oz serving of rum with diet coke contains only around 97 calories.
Bloody Mary:
A 5 oz serving of bloody mary contains around 120 calories, making it a good option for those who want a savory drink that's not too high in calories.
It's important to remember that these drinks are only low in calories if consumed in moderation. Drinking too much of any alcoholic beverage can have negative effects on your health and weight.
